      About Highland House AFH

      Highland House AFH, which is licensed for six residents, sits in Edmonds, WA and provides care in a home-like setting that looks after seniors who need help with everyday things like bathing, eating, dressing, and getting around, and they've got trained attendants on hand for things like medication reminders, diabetes care, and even two-person transfers, so folks who need a bit more help can still manage with dignity. This place is regulated by the state and follows rules set by the Department of Social Services, and they take private pay, long-term care insurance, and Veterans Aid and Attendance, but they don't take Medicare unless Medicare certifies them, which makes payment something people always want to double-check. People who live here get a choice of private or shared rooms-sometimes even private bathrooms-plus wheelchair-resistant showers and spaces set up so those using walkers or chairs can get around safely without fuss. The staff supports 24-hour care and handles laundry, hygiene, incontinence support, and even special diets if needed, especially for conditions like high blood pressure or diabetes, and they can help with grooming by arranging for a mobile barber or hairdresser. Highland House AFH has activities to help keep spirits up, like on-site and off-site trips, movie nights, music, art, and even animal therapy, and for those with memory problems, they've got planned schedules, fitness routines, and social evenings to keep folks engaged and active. Meal times come with home-cooked food, and there's support for people who need extra help eating, and for those with spiritual needs, devotional services and activities happen right in the home. Pets are allowed, at least cats, and caregivers work to keep the atmosphere calm with indoor and outdoor common areas, gardens, and plenty of sunshine when the weather allows, plus recreation rooms and spaces for books or games. Transportation gets arranged for doctor visits and errands, and when needed, there's respite care for families who need a break and hospice care when someone's health becomes serious. With the place being small, everyone gets to know each other, and it's easier for staff-sometimes called team members or attendants-to pay attention to each person, making it a setting that many families find brings peace of mind, and though the amenities and activities can change, it's always worth asking what's new or available now, especially since places like Highland House AFH often change schedules to fit residents' needs. Starting price usually sits around $3,000 per month, but since payment and care needs go hand in hand, talking things over with their team clears up a lot of the details.

Respite care in assisted living communities provides temporary, short-term relief for primary caregivers by offering professional care for their loved ones. It allows individuals to stay in an assisted living community for a limited time, giving caregivers a break while ensuring residents receive necessary support and assistance with daily activities.
